## Further Reading

The Gleanbot sweeper deletes orphaned volumes, stale snapshots, and unattached load balancers across Corvane staging environments. For the weekly eng sync, the most useful background is the design doc covering detection heuristics and the two-pass confirmation model, plus the incident writeup from when Gleanbot deleted a volume that was still mid-migration. Retention rules and exclusion tags are documented separately. The full reading list, with summaries, is maintained on the internal page below.

wiki page, bagaf-fawip: https://harbor.tolvaqsys.local/pages/repo/pages/secrets/eac969ffc71f356b

Present: all department heads; chaired by R. Casperel. Agenda item one: next year's headcount plan. Finance presented three scenarios; the middle case adds twelve roles, weighted toward the Fenbrook service centre. Operations flagged attrition risk in logistics and requested two additional supervisors. It was agreed that hiring freezes lift in January, subject to Q4 results. Each head will submit revised staffing requests within ten working days. The full confidential staffing rationale is recorded in the note below.

internal memo for kawip-hadug: Headcount on the Wenwyn team goes from 7 to 140 by the end of January. Gross margin on Wenwyn came in at 20 percent against a plan of 15 percent.

## Local Setup — Osprey Firmware Update Channel

This section covers running the Osprey update channel locally. Clone the repo, install dependencies with the bundled toolchain script, and start the mock device fleet via `make fleet`. The channel service expects a Postgres instance holding the firmware manifest tables; schema migrations run automatically on first boot. Flash artifacts are stubbed locally, so no signing keys are needed. Once the mock fleet is up, configure the manifest database using the connection string below.

primary connection of yagep-kahip = redis://giliel_svc:zYiKsLL2PLpfPL@db-348f.xolmarsys.corp:5432/fenwyn